Romney the technocrat?

So says Peter Canellos, the Globe's Washington, D.C. bureau chief, in today's "National Perspective" column on Michael Bloomberg.

Writes Canellos: "Other candidates, such as Bloomberg's mayoral predecessor Rudy Giuliani, former Massachusetts governor Mitt Romney, and many Democrats, are offering their own messages of competence-not-ideology."

What th--?

Seriously, I'm not sure where Canellos is getting this. Consider these bon mots from our former governor:
"My view is, we ought to double Guantamo."--May '07 Republican presidential debate

"This is not the time for us to shrink from conservative principles. It is time for us to stand in strength."--Conservative Political Action Committee conference, February '07

"America is under attack from almost every direction. We have been attacked by murderous terrorists here in this great city. Our employers and jobs are threatened by low-cost, highly skilled labor from abroad. American values are under attack from within."--2004 Republican National Convention speech
Am I missing something?
